Internet Janitor posted:for rich people for whom money and prescriptions are no object, is there any reason not to be on paxlovid constantly as a prophylactic? i guess some people get the weird taste side effects... yeah aside from the variably-unpleasant side effects, medicine interactions are an issue, and i think it's just a little rough on your liver generally from what i understand, so being on it short-term is no biggie but chronically could be more seriously damaging however, re: the general idea, there are other 3CLP inhibitors (same mechanism as paxlovid) in development/study phase that are thought to be as-or-more effective at replication inhibition while being way more biologically available and stable. in particular, ISM3312 (invented in canada, i think, and in testing in china) is hoped/suspected to be sufficiently bioavailable that you don't need to co-administer with ritonavir, meaning the level of side effects / liver risks / drug interactions should drop precipitously. in theory, something like that could be a good candidate for long-term administration. there are probably others in testing but i remember a bit of hype around that one. hopefully the studies pan out, but who knows.

Zantie posted:Another lab just dropped their results into Twitter. They, in line with the other two labs, found that it was less of a concern than previously thought. Ryan's still got some good points though about if antibodies from a recent infection then how is it still circulating in large enough numbers for it to get picked up via sequencing. Here’s my hypothesis: Pirola has carved out a niche for itself. It’s relatively good at infecting international travellers, who tend to have had recent XBB infections and put themselves in a lot of superspreader situations, but it can’t move quite as fast as Eris and Fornax in the general population. So in addition to the “what if” of Pirola simply becoming better at infecting cells, we have “what if the general population starts to look more like international travellers, as XBB seropositivity increases and people are brought together in the fall and winter?”
